CC7: The Challenge That Enriches the Game

One of the game’s most intriguing aspects is the weekly challenge mode known as CC7. This mode tests players' skills in overcoming dynamically generated scenarios that mirror real-life environmental and political challenges faced by ancient rulers. CC7 is renowned for its difficulty, pushing players to employ creativity and strategic acumen to solve complex problems within a limited timeframe.

In recent weeks, the CC7 challenge has focused on climate patterns and resource scarcity, drawing parallels to contemporary discussions on sustainability and resource management. This aspect of the game not only enhances its replayability but also ensures that players gain a deeper understanding of the historical contexts that influenced the Maya and continue to affect modern societies.
